Just in case you don’t know: antimicrobial resistance is a situation when bacteria, viruses, and fungi become resistant to antibiotics, so that antibiotics won’t help fighting infectious diseases anymore. This resistance is mostly based in the gut, where the microbes carry genetically encoded ways to survive contact with antibiotics. So can we do something to […]

A recent study investigated the brain aging process of the Tsimane people (the Bolivian Amazon) and found that the difference in brain volumes between middle age and old age is 70% (!) smaller than in Western populations! In other words, the shrinkage of their brain was much slower than in our modern society. And as […]
